The mechanics of modern welcome offers

Today’s DFS incentives go far beyond a simple credit. Most platforms now offer structured bonuses that can effectively double your starting bankroll - but only if you understand how they work. Deposit match promotions are the most common, with some sites offering up to a 100% match on your first deposit, often capped between 100 and 250 . These require a minimum deposit - typically 5 or 10 - and the matched amount is released as bonus entries or site credit.

Then there are no-deposit bonuses, like the 10 free play offered by certain apps just for signing up. These let you enter contests without risking your own cash, making them ideal for testing the platform. But availability isn’t universal. Understanding playthrough and expiration terms

The true value of any bonus isn’t just in the headline number - it’s in the fine print. Most reputable DFS platforms now use a 1x rollover requirement, meaning you must use your bonus amount in contests at least once before withdrawals unlock. That’s a major improvement over traditional sportsbooks, where 5x or higher rollovers made bonuses nearly impossible to cash out.

Still, timing matters. Some sites give you only 30 days to meet the requirement, while others, like Underdog, offer up to 60 days - a significant advantage for casual players. Miss the window, and the bonus vanishes. So while the offer might look generous at first, the clock can quietly erase its value.

Geographic restrictions and eligibility

Here’s a hard truth: not all bonuses are available to all players. DFS legality varies by state, and major platforms like Underdog or DraftKings DFS aren’t accessible in places like New York, New Jersey, Michigan, or Pennsylvania. Even within permitted states, GPS verification is often required at signup. Jumping through the wrong geo-fence means your account could be restricted or denied outright. Bref, always verify your eligibility before entering a promo code - otherwise, you risk losing access before you even start.

Common Queries About DFS Incentives

I missed the 30-day window on my credit; is there any way to recover it?

In most cases, expired bonus funds are permanently lost. Platforms rarely offer extensions, even for inactive accounts. Some may provide goodwill gestures for loyal users, but this isn’t guaranteed. The best approach is to track expiration dates and use credits early.

How does a 'Risk-Free' entry actually differ from a standard 'Deposit Match'?

A deposit match gives you bonus funds upfront, while a risk-free entry refunds your stake if your contest loses, usually as site credit. The latter lets you play without initial risk but doesn’t add extra funds to your balance if you win.

Can I stack multiple promo codes on a single DFS platform?

No, most DFS apps allow only one welcome offer per user. Even if multiple codes are advertised, they typically can’t be combined. The system will apply the most valuable eligible offer, but stacking is not permitted under standard terms.

Is there a hidden cost when using the 'copy picks' social feature?

Generally, no. Copying expert lineups is free on most platforms. However, some may charge a small fee for premium analysts or require a subscription to unlock advanced features. Always check the details before using a paid tier.

What happens to my bonus if a game in my lineup is postponed?

If a game is postponed or canceled, most platforms void the contest entry and refund your entry fee - including bonus funds used. The credit typically returns to your account, preserving your promotional balance as long as the contest doesn’t score.
